¿Cómo logra el sistema de gestión creado con vb+access compartir bases de datos dentro de la red de área local?
1) En primer lugar, el programa se divide en un programa VB front-end y una base de datos back-end.
Los programas VB pueden usar objetos de datos o controles de datos de Ado, etc., usar de manera flexible declaraciones de consulta estructuradas SQL para operar la base de datos ACCESS en segundo plano y mostrar información a través de varios controles de formulario.
Utilizando el Asistente para dividir la base de datos de ACCESS, puede dividir fácilmente la base de datos en dos partes: el frontend y el backend. Además de conservar todos los objetos en la tabla, el frontend también incluye: consultas, formularios e informes. , macros o códigos. Y se vincula automáticamente a la tabla de la base de datos en segundo plano, mientras que el fondo solo conserva los objetos de la tabla. Abra la base de datos - Herramientas - Utilidades de base de datos - Dividir base de datos. Haga clic en el botón "Dividir base de datos" después de que aparezca el "Divisor de base de datos" y aparezca el cuadro de diálogo "Crear base de datos backend". Después de que aparezca el "Divisor de base de datos", haga clic en el botón "Dividir base de datos" para que aparezca el cuadro de diálogo "Crear base de datos backend". La base de datos de front-end dividida conserva el nombre de la base de datos original, mientras que el nombre de la base de datos de back-end suele ir seguido de _be, y puede especificar que la base de datos de back-end se guarde en una carpeta específica.
2) **** Aprecie la carpeta donde se encuentra la base de datos back-end. Abra el Explorador, seleccione la carpeta, haga clic derecho y seleccione Disfrutar y proteger. Seleccione la casilla de verificación "***Compartir esta carpeta en la red". Si desea que otras máquinas en la red puedan actualizar los datos, marque Permitir que los usuarios de la red cambien mis archivos.
Lo anterior toma Windows XP como ejemplo, otros sistemas serán diferentes.
3) Asigne la unidad de red. Haga clic con el botón derecho en Entorno de red o seleccione el menú Herramientas en el Explorador y seleccione Map Network Drive. Especifique una unidad (letra de disco), como M. Esta unidad M es arbitraria, puede especificar cualquier otra letra de disco, pero deberá asignar una letra de disco uniforme a la carpeta donde se encuentra la base de datos backend en todas las máquinas de la LAN que comparten la base de datos. Especifique la carpeta a la que está asignada esta unidad de disco, es decir, la carpeta donde se encuentra la base de datos back-end ********. Puede hacer clic en el botón Examinar para seleccionar o ingresar directamente. Marque "Reconectar al iniciar sesión"
4) Vuelva a vincular el enlace de la tabla de la biblioteca front-end.
5) Después de completar el trabajo anterior, se completa el trabajo en la máquina. El siguiente paso es asignar la carpeta **** enjoy a la misma unidad (unidad de disco) de cada máquina en la LAN. . Como por ejemplo m.
6) El último paso es distribuir la biblioteca front-end. Todas las configuraciones para la base de datos **** disfrutan del trabajo en la red de área local. Después de actualizar la función de la biblioteca en el futuro, simplemente distribuya la biblioteca directamente.
Referencia: /u010240338/article/details/9025457.